1 Timothy 3:8
Likewise [must] the deacons. The ancient church understood that the
seven appointed in Acts were the first deacons (Acts 6:5). They were
not called deacons, but filled a diaconate. In Philippians 1:1 we find deacons
existing. Their office seemed to have been to look after the temporal
matters of the church, and especially to care for the poor and the
widows (Acts 6:1).
Not doubletongued. Not saying one thing to one man, and another
thing to others.
Not greedy of filthy lucre. Men who are covetous and unscrupulous
as to modes of getting money are not to be chosen.
